Understanding Cannabinoids: It's Easy!
Cannabinoids include chemical compounds naturally found in the hemp plant. These substances interact with your body's endocannabinoid system, a complex network of receptors and neurotransmitters that regulate various functions, such as mood. There be found over 100 known cannabinoids, with the two most popular being THC and CBD.
THC, or tetrahydrocannabinol, is responsible for the mind-altering effects of cannabis. CBD, or cannabidiol, on the other aspect, does not produce these effects and is sometimes used to alleviate symptoms like pain.
